Urban infrastructure analysis
Map analysis
Integration with 3 data sources: OpenStreetMap, city APIs (public transport), and bike paths from local communities. Identified "ecological corridors" — routes with minimal environmental impact.
Use cases
5 key scenarios created: "Morning Commute", "Family Stroll", "Low-CO2 Delivery", "Tourist Route", "Urgent Trip". Each includes priority analysis and decision points.
Complex data design
A carbon footprint visualization system has been developed: color gradients (red → green), iconography, progress bars with a clear metric of "grams CO2 per km". Information is visible at a glance, with details available on request.

Usage scenarios
  • Scenario #1

    Morning Commute

    User: Maria, 32, manager



    Goal: Get to work in 25 minutes with minimal carbon footprint



    Solution: Route "10 min walk → 12 min tram → 3 min walk" instead of taxi. Savings: 1.2 kg CO2 = 0.5 trees.

  • Scenario #2
    Family Stroll

    User: Dmitry with children aged 5 and 8


    Goal: A walk with stops near parks and away from noisy highways


    Solution: The "Child Safety" filter hides highways. Fountains, playgrounds, and shaded alleys have been added.

  • Scenario #3
    Urgent Delivery

    User: Delivery service courier



    Goal: Minimize time while maintaining eco-friendliness



    Solution: A compromise route with switching between bicycle and metro. Time trade-off (+7%) vs. ecology (-68% CO2).

Complex data visualization
How to make carbon footprint clear and motivating
Data visualization principles
  • Tree-planting metaphor instead of abstract CO2 grams
  • Color code: red (harmful) → orange (neutral) → green (beneficial)
  • Comparison with familiar objects: "Savings = 3 smartphone charges"
  • Personal contribution progress bar to the city's ecology

  • Simplification of filters
    Reduced from 9 to 4 key parameters. Presets added: "Maximum Eco", "Fast + Eco", "For Children".
  • Visual emphasis
    Relocation of CO2 savings information to the top of the screen. Added a "growing tree" animation when selecting an eco-route.
